Output e1b53c24c49392cefc1d3613678f1ab0290eda9c81714d5ccbe55e0a7f1e6399:11

value
558951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c4539aa11aa9d57190861ec534cfba2609dfe2d OP_EQUAL
address
3LK6hXohv9XQztVMAsvfGYU1sBRqBJkD8u
transaction
e1b53c24c49392cefc1d3613678f1ab0290eda9c81714d5ccbe55e0a7f1e6399
spent
true